WebThe standard blessed method for type punning in both C and C++ is memcpy. This may seem a little heavy handed but the optimizer should recognize the use of memcpy for type punning and optimize it away and generate a register to register move. WebApr 1, 2013 · void * has nothing to do with type-punning. Its main purposes are: To allow for generic allocation and freeing operations that don't care about the type of the object the caller is storing there (e.g. malloc and free).
